The Global Status of CCS: 2011
The Global CCS Institute is pleased to announce the release of The Global Status of CCS: 2011 report.
The report is the only existing global review of project developments and issues relevant to the deployment of CCS.
It has been developed using the most up-to-date knowledge of CCS projects and incorporates funding and regulatory activities.
It is intended as a comprehensive reference guide for industry, government, research bodies and the broader community.
